Top THREE Dog Agility Trainers in Blythburgh, Suffolk

Pooch Paws

Pooch Paws is a top behaviourist in Norfolk that offers puppy and dog training and behaviour programmes, as well as agility classes. They use kind and gentle methods and are members of the ABTC and other professional organisations. 

They have a rating of 4.9 out of 5 based on 98 reviews. Pooch Paws was established by Katey Aldred in 2005 and now has two other team members, Berni Black and James Marjoram. 

They offer various services, such as classes, one-to-one sessions, workshops, and online courses.

Paws 4 Training

Paws 4 Training is a dog training centre in Hempnall, Norwich, that offers training classes for puppies and dogs of all levels, including fun agility and pet gundog training.

They are ADTB-qualified trainers and use positive reinforcement techniques. They have a rating of 4.9 out of 5 based on 50 reviews. Paws 4 Training was started by Jane Stacey in 2015 as an outdoor dog training class held at Abandoned Animals in Prestatyn. 

Later, she found an indoor venue for instructing, became a member of the Kennel Club Accreditation Scheme and qualified with the PDTI . They offer various services, such as group classes, private classes, and workshops.
